Ford Taurus launched in the Middle East with Updated Design, Hybrid Power, and Advanced Tech

Ford Middle East and North Africa has officially launched the new Ford Taurus across the region, marking the arrival of a comprehensively updated version of the brand’s long-running midsize sedan. Building on its established reputation in some GCC countries, the latest Taurus features refreshed styling, upgraded technology, and a choice of efficient powertrains aimed at regional customer preferences.

Tesla Model 3 Starting Price Drops in the UAE

Tesla has introduced its most affordable vehicle in the UAE with the launch of the Model 3 Standard, aimed at accelerating electric vehicle adoption in the region. Since its global debut, the Model 3 has played a key role in bringing EVs into the mainstream, and the new entry-level variant makes Tesla ownership more accessible than ever in the UAE.

All-New Lincoln Navigator Arrives in the Middle East

Lincoln Middle East has officially unveiled the all-new Lincoln Navigator, marking the arrival of the next generation of the brand’s flagship luxury SUV in the region. Nearly three decades after creating the premium full-size SUV category, the Navigator returns with a new design, an exquisitely crafted interior, and advanced connected technologies tailored to the discerning tastes of Middle East drivers.

All-New Chevrolet Captiva EV and Plug-In Hybrid Debut in the Middle East

Chevrolet has expanded its Captiva lineup in the Middle East with the introduction of two electrified models — the Captiva Electric Vehicle (EV) and the Captiva Plug-In Hybrid (PHEV). Building on the popularity of the original Captiva as a family-focused, value-packed SUV, the new variants mark the brand’s move to make future-forward mobility more accessible across the region.

2026 Chevrolet Cruze makes regional comeback with fresh design and tech upgrades

Chevrolet has officially confirmed the return of the Cruze nameplate to the Middle East with the launch of the all-new 2026 model. Once a staple in the compact sedan segment, the Chevrolet Cruze is back with a modern design, new tech features, and improved efficiency. However, the UAE is not among the initial launch markets, with availability confirmed for KSA, Kuwait, Qatar, Oman, Jordan, Lebanon, Iraq, and Bahrain.
